Question 1024378: There are currently 73 million cars in a certaint country increasing by 1.7% annually how many years will it take for this country to reach 91 million cars? Round to the nearest year

73 * 1.017^N = 91 < note, an increase of 1.7% is the same as multiplying by 1.017

1.017^N = 91/73 or 1.2466

log of both sides
log 1.017^N = log 1.2466
rearrange to
N log 1.017 = log 1.2466
N= log 1.2466/log 1.017
N= 13.075
Ask your teacher if you round down to nearest integer, or up to 14, the year sales actually exceeded 91 M
